The Nairobi River, which flows right through Kenya’s capital city, Nairobi, has been very polluted for a long time. That means it’s dirty and not safe for people or animals. But things are about to change! ποΈ
Kenya’s President, William Ruto, kicked off a huge project to clean up and restore the Nairobi River. And guess what? A company from the Chinese mainland called Energy China is leading the way! π°πͺπ¨π³
This project isn’t just about cleaning the river. They are also going to build new homes that are affordable, which means people can buy or rent them without spending too much money. π The whole project will cost about 50 billion Kenyan shillings (that’s around $388 million)! π°
President Ruto said that cleaning up the river will create new jobs, help people stay healthy, and make the city beautiful again. “This project will help us make Nairobi a cleaner and more respectable city,” he said. π
They will build a long sewer line to carry dirty water away, clean up the riverbanks, plant trees, and make parks where people can relax. π³ They will also build new homes for people who lost their houses because of floods. π‘
Energy China will use cool technologies and work with people who live there to get the job done faster. π Li Cheng, a manager at Energy China, said it will take about two years to finish the river cleanup. ποΈ
This big project will help the environment, make life better for people in Nairobi, and maybe even bring more tourists to visit! π¦π
